Leading 7 Software Testing Misconceptions
Many enterprises nowadays implement formal software testing strategy to launch a high quality software application. Also, many businesses nowadays test the software constantly and under real user conditions. But several entrepreneurs still do not realize the value of testing in the software development lifecycle, and the benefits associated with testing the software early on and continuously. They are still sceptical about the benefits associated with software testing and believe several software tests myths.
Decoding 7 Common Myths about Software Tests
1) Testing Increases a Software Application's Time to Marketplace
While developing a new software program, enterprises explore ways to beat conclusion by reducing its time to market. The QA professionals have to get both time and effort to evaluate the software's quality under varying conditions and according to predefined requirements. That is why; many businesses assume that the program screening process increases the product's time to market. Yet each enterprise has several options to get its software tested elaborately without increasing its time to market. A company can certainly reduce testing time by automating various testing activities. Likewise, it can implement snello methodology to unify the coding and testing process seamlessly.
2) Testing Boosts Software Development Cost
An enterprise needs to deploy skilled testers and invest in robust test automation tools to evaluate the quality of the software comprehensively. Of which is why; many entrepreneurs think that software testing boosts software development cost significantly. But an enterprise can reduce software testing cost in a number of ways. It can opt for open source and free test automation tools to reduce both testing some cost. Also, the software tests results will help the business to generate more income by launching a high quality software application, in addition to avoiding maintenance and correction cost.
3) Test Automation Makes Handbook Testing Obsolete
Test motorisation tools help QA professionals to execute and do it again a variety of assessments without putting extra time and effort. Hence, many enterprises explore ways to automate all testing activities. The entrepreneurs often disregard the shortcomings of various test automation tools. These people forget the simple fact that test automation tools absence the capability to imagine and make decisions. Unlike human being testers, the test automation tools cannot examine an application's usability and consumer experience precisely. Nowadays, a software application must deliver optimal user experience to become popular and profitable. Hence, an enterprise must incorporate human testers and test automation tools to evaluate the quality of its software more specifically.
4) Elaborate Testing Can make an Application Flawless
While screening an application application, testers perform a variety of checks to evaluate its accessibility, functionality, performance, usability, security, and user experience. These people even identify and repair all defects and satisfaction issues in the software before its release. The test results also help businesses to choose if the software meets all predefined requirements. But the user experience delivered by a software may differ according to customer conditions and environments. Typically the testers cannot identify all bugs or defects in an application despite carrying out and repeating many checks. Hence, the company must be prepared to get the bugs or issues found in the application after its release.
5) Developers are not required to Check the Software
An enterprise must deploy skilled QA professionals to get the quality of its software analyzes thoroughly and effectively. Nevertheless it can always speed up the software testing process by making the programmers and testers work together. The developers can further determine the standard of application computer code by performing unit testing and integration testing all through the coding process. Similarly, they must perform state of mind testing to ensure that the software is operating according to predefined requirements. Agile methodology further requires enterprises to unify software development and testing activities to offer high quality software applications. The project management approach requires businesses to test the software consistently by a team consisting both programmers and testers.
6) Testing Process Begins after Software Development Method
The traditional waterfall model allows business to start out the software testing process after completing the software development process. But the conventional software testing model does not meet the requirements of complex and cross-platform software applications. A steady increase is being noted in the number of enterprises transitioning from waterfall models to agile methodology and DevOps. As mentioned earlier, souple methodology required businesses to test the software continuously, together with making the coders and testers work as a single team. Similarly, DevOps requires businesses to unify software development, tests, and deployment processes. Therefore, the testers nowadays start testing an application from the original phase of the software development lifecycle.
7) No Need to Deploy Skilled Software Testers
Small business owners still believe the only task of a testing professional is to find bugs or defects in an application. The even do not consider software testing requires skill and creativity. The misconception often makes businesses get their software tested by randomly people. An enterprise can involve real users in the software testing process to examine the application's usability and user experience better. But it must deploy skilled testers to get the software evaluated under varying user conditions and environments. The skilled testers understand how to identify the defects and performance issues in the software by creating many test scenarios. The even produce elaborate test results to facilitate the decision production process.
